What public transport options serve Surfers Paradise?

Surfers Paradise is serviced by Kinetic Gold Coast bus routes and the G:link light rail system, which runs north‑south with multiple stations throughout the precinct

What is the climate like in Surfers Paradise?

The area enjoys a warm, steady climate year‑round, with summer highs around 40 °C and winter lows near 2 °C. Sea temperatures range from about 21 °C in winter to 27 °C in summer

What major events are held in Surfers Paradise?

Annual highlights include the Gold Coast Marathon in July, the Surfers Paradise Festival featuring music, food and art, and the Australian Sand Sculpting Championships on the foreshore

Are there any heritage‑listed sites nearby?

Yes, nearby heritage listings include the iconic Pink Poodle sign at 18 Fern Street, the Kinkabool building on Hanlan Street, and the Matey Memorial bronze statue on Cavill Avenue

What is the current population of Surfers Paradise?

According to the 2021 census, Surfers Paradise has a population of 26,412 residents
